Kids sport help
Another round of $200 sport vouchers are now on offer.
The Get Active Kids Voucher Program helps eligible families cover the costs of sports memberships, registration fees, uniforms and equipment.
Eligible families who hold health care cards or other concession cards can apply for vouchers of up to $200 per child (aged up to 18).
For more information and to apply for a voucher visit getactive.vic.gov.au/vouchers.
Support for early childhood
The 2024-25 Innovation Grants Program is now open with grants from $5,000 to $50,000 available to early childhood services who are innovating to keep early career teachers and educators in the workforce.
The grants support teachers and educators in the first five years of their career, and applicants are encouraged to work together with other providers to develop programs and services that enable early career educators to stay in the workforce.
Applications close at 5pm on Friday November 1. To apply or find out more visit vic.gov.au/innovation-grants-program.
Multicultural media grants
Grants of up to $25,000 are available through the 2024-25 Multicultural Media Grants program to support multicultural media organisations across the state.
Applications for the grants close on November 8.
For more information and to apply, visit vic.gov.au/multicultural-media-grants-program.
Volunteers survey
All volunteers are encouraged to take part in new research to gauge the state of volunteering in Victoria.
The Volunteering Victoria research team is hosting in depth qualitative research sessions online and in person for volunteer managers, emergency services volunteers, Volunteering Victoria members, youth volunteers and online volunteers in both regional and metropolitan locations.
To attend a forum online or in person or take the volunteer managers' survey please go to www.volunteeringvictoria.org.au/get-involved-state-of-volunteering-vic/#forums
